GU1 3LF is a residential postcode located on Epsom Road, Guildford, GU1. It is the 787th largest postcode in the GU1 area.
It contains 30 residential addresses consisting of 1 house, 28 flats and 1 unknown and the most common type of property is a period flat built between 1800 and 1911.
The average house value is £374,157. Sales values have increased in the last 12 months by 1.4% and Rental values have increased by 5.8%.
Property sale values range from £183,677 for a leasehold flat, with 1 bedrooms split across 291 square feet of gross internal area and has no outside space to £1,444,157 for a freehold house, with 5 bedrooms split across 1,994 square feet of gross internal area and has a garden.
Average £/ft2 for properties in GU1 3LF is £688/ft2.
Properties achieve a rental yield of between 3.3% and 6.2%, and rental values range from £848 to £3,924 per month.
The last sale was 28 Sep 2021 for £475,000 and since then the market in the area has increased by 2.3%. The postcode has had a total of 4 sales since 1995.
GU1 3LF has seen 4 sales in the last three years and no sales in the last twelve months.
